In order to reassess the role of duodenal ulcers as a cause of acute upper gastrointestinal hemorrhage in patients with chronic renal failure, 20 consecutive patients with moderate to severe chronic renal failure and a comparison group of patients without renal disease who were seen for acute upper gastrointestinal hemorrhage were reviewed.
Gastric bleeding
sites (
gastric ulcer
in 35 percent and gastritis in 20 percent) rather than duodenal ulcers were the most common sources of bleeding and were significantly associated with the use of ulcerogenic drugs. Patients with renal disease in whom acute upper gastrointestinal hemorrhage developed had significantly more morbidity and a trend toward higher mortality than the comparison group of patients without renal disease. It is concluded that gastric mucosal lesions, at least in part due to the use of ulcerogenic drugs, are the most common cause of significant acute upper gastrointestinal hemorrhage in patients with chronic renal failure.

Gastric bleeding
is one of the irritant problems in ulcer patients. In this study, we evaluated hemostatic action of ulcer-coating powder (EGF-endospray) on
gastric ulcer
animal models. EGF-endospray, containing epidermal growth factor, is designed to be applied through an endoscope. Hemostatic action of the EGF-endospray was evaluated on gastric hemorrhage models of rabbits and micro-pigs. The EGF-endospray was directly applied onto a mucosal resection (MR)-induced gastric bleeding focus in a rabbit model. In a porcine model, the EGF-endospray was applied once via an endoscopy to a bleeding lesion created by endoscopic submucosal dissection. The bleeding focus was then observed via an endoscope. In the rabbit model, EGF-endospray treatment significantly shortened mean bleeding time in comparison with other treatments (104.3 vs 548.0 vs 393.2 s for the EGF-endospray, the non-treated control and the epinephrine injection, respectively). In the micro-pig model, EGF-endospray showed immediate hemostatic action and prolonged covering of the bleeding focus for over 72 h. Histology proved mucosal thickness was more efficiently recovered in all EGF-endospray treated animals. The results of the present study suggest that the EGF-endospray is a promising hemostatic agent for GI bleeding.
